Description
Tintinnabulum in the shape of a phallus / satyr (it has equid legs instead of testicles) on which a naked female figure rides, holding a crown. The tail also is shaped like a phallus. Two bells hang from the lower part. Surely it was a magical object or talisman to expel evil spirits.
